Drive-thru flu shots for Veterans this week
September 27, 2017
NEW ORLEANS – Southeast Louisiana Veterans Health Care System (SLVHCS) will host a drive thru flu shot clinic this week at the new Veterans medical center at the Galvez Street entrance.
The drive thru will take place Thursday and Friday from 8 a.m. to noon, and 1 p.m. to 2:30 p.m., as well as Saturday Sept. 30 and Oct. 7 from 8 to 12.
SLVHCS will also offer the drive thru flu clinic at its Baton Rouge South outpatient clinic in the parking lot at 7850 Anselmo Lane this Saturday and next from 8 a.m. to noon.
“We want to make it very convenient for busy Veterans to receive their flu shots this year,” said SLVHCS Director Fernando O. Rivera, FACHE. “These drive thru clinics offer a quick and easy way to stay healthy this flu season, with no appointment necessary.”
Veterans must have a valid VA ID card to use this free service. The flu shot is the best way to prevent getting the flu this season. Protect yourself and your family.
